To effectively communicate and collaborate in adult education programs, it is essential to understand the key terms and vocabulary associated with this topic. Effective communication is the foundation of successful collaboration, and it involves the ability to convey ideas, thoughts, and opinions in a clear and concise manner. This can be achieved through various means, including verbal and non-verbal communication, active listening, and the use of appropriate language.
Verbal communication refers to the use of words to convey meaning, while non-verbal communication involves the use of body language, facial expressions, and tone of voice to convey meaning. Active listening is a critical aspect of effective communication, as it involves paying attention to the speaker, understanding their perspective, and responding in a way that shows empathy and understanding. The use of appropriate language is also essential, as it involves using language that is respectful, inclusive, and free from bias.
Collaboration is the process of working together to achieve a common goal, and it requires effective communication, mutual respect, and a willingness to compromise. In adult education programs, collaboration can involve working with colleagues, students, and other stakeholders to achieve a common goal, such as developing a new curriculum or implementing a new teaching strategy. Collaborative learning is a teaching approach that involves students working together to achieve a common goal, and it can be an effective way to promote critical thinking, problem-solving, and teamwork.
Another key term associated with communicating and collaborating effectively is emotional intelligence. Emotional intelligence refers to the ability to recognize and understand emotions in oneself and others, and to use this awareness to guide thought and behavior. In adult education programs, emotional intelligence is essential for building strong relationships with students, colleagues, and other stakeholders, and for creating a positive and supportive learning environment. Emotionally intelligent educators are able to recognize and manage their own emotions, as well as the emotions of their students, and to use this awareness to create a positive and supportive learning environment.
In addition to emotional intelligence, cultural competence is also an essential aspect of communicating and collaborating effectively in adult education programs. Cultural competence refers to the ability to understand and appreciate the cultural differences and nuances that exist among students, colleagues, and other stakeholders. Culturally competent educators are able to recognize and respect the cultural differences that exist among their students, and to use this awareness to create a positive and inclusive learning environment.

Feedback is also an essential aspect of communicating and collaborating effectively in adult education programs, as it involves the ability to give and receive feedback in a way that is constructive and respectful. Constructive feedback is specific, timely, and focused on behavior rather than personality, and it is essential for improving performance and achieving goals. Receiving feedback is also essential, as it involves the ability to listen to and act on feedback in a way that is open-minded and receptive.
To give effective feedback, it is essential to be specific, timely, and focused on behavior rather than personality. Feedback should also be respectful and constructive, and it should be given in a way that is clear and concise.
